Sea Turtles

Kari Schuetz (author)

Publisher: Bellwether Media Inc. ISBN: 9781626174221

Sea turtles have strong flippers to propel them through water. These shelled animals may migrate thousands of miles to lay eggs. Although they are not agile on shore, some can swim faster than 20 miles (32 kilometers) per hour! Many sea turtles live to be well over 30 years old. Walruses

Kari Schuetz (author)

Publisher: Bellwether Media Inc. ISBN: 9781626174245

Walruses have big tusks under hairy mustaches. These animals use their long teeth to fight or lift themselves out of the water. Walruses have thick skin and a lot of blubber. They can weigh more than 3,000 pounds (1,361 kilograms)! Find out more about these massive creatures in this book for beginning readers.

Tylosaurus

Karen Carr, Gerry Bailey (author)

Publisher: Crabtree Publishing Company ISBN: 9781427197092

This book tells the story of Tylosaurus, which swam in the prehistoric seas between 87 and 82 million years ago. It was a fierce marine reptile that used its sharp teeth and huge jaws to feed on sharks and other marine reptiles, such as plesiosaurs, as well as fish. A Tylosaurus could grow as long as 50 feet (15 meters) and was a superb swimmer.
